Review of the Mould King GBC Great Ball Contraption No. Planetary Elevator (26015)

The Mould King GBC Great Ball Contraption No. Planetary Elevator (26015) is a captivating brick-building set that brings engineering and creativity together in a fascinating way. With 1009 pieces, this set is designed for ages 14 and up, making it a perfect challenge for teens and adults who enjoy intricate builds and mechanical marvels.

Build Experience:
The assembly process is engaging and rewarding, offering a good balance of complexity and fun. The instructions are clear, guiding you through the construction of a fully functional Great Ball Contraption (GBC). The set includes a motor and battery case, which bring the model to life with smooth, automated motion. Watching the balls travel through the transparent channels and rotating mechanisms is incredibly satisfying. However, some smaller pieces can be fiddly, and the build requires patience—especially when aligning the gears and ensuring the mechanism runs smoothly.

Design and Features:
The design is both sleek and functional, measuring 49.2 cm in length and 16.2 cm in height. The central rotating device, which swings 360 degrees, is the highlight of the build, effortlessly transporting colorful balls through the track. Features like the gear adjustment device and the independent transparent ball box add to the realism and interactivity. The mechanical transmission device that pushes the balls up and down is a clever touch, showcasing the principles of engineering in a playful way.

Playability and Durability:
Once built, the GBC is a joy to watch in action. The motor ensures consistent movement, and the gravity swing mechanism at the top of the turntable adds an element of physics-based fun. However, the model can be a bit delicate—rough handling might misalign the tracks or gears, so it’s best suited for display or careful play. The pieces are of decent quality for a Mould King set, though they don’t feel as premium as some other brands.

Value for Money:
For a 1009-piece set with a working motor, the Mould King GBC offers solid value. It’s a great choice for hobbyists interested in kinetic models or GBC enthusiasts looking to expand their collection. The educational aspect—demonstrating mechanical concepts like gravity and motion—adds to its appeal for both builders and learners.
